Output e20eba7eaa35694fb53b23f7af1c96f824957c9c065fdbfafd4a28e2ecc7601e:1

value
937824480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8c81b485b63a2e0654f5eb2d74945b11e393e94 OP_EQUALVERIFY OP_CHECKSIG
address
1Hr33wpjhNkZzxpAhXoAQ19vK2u3myFrWd
transaction
e20eba7eaa35694fb53b23f7af1c96f824957c9c065fdbfafd4a28e2ecc7601e
spent
true